[0040] Technical scheme of the present invention is mainly divided into following two parts:
[0041] 1) Quickly establish the 3D model and scene database of the simplified scene through the simplified CAD modeling method. Establishing a 3D scene database first requires modeling and analysis of different types of scenes, and reduces modeling complexity through reasonable simplification. For urban microcells, on the one hand, compared with trees, lakes, etc., buildings have the greatest influence on radio wave propagation, so only buildings are considered in the modeling process; on the other hand, as the range of microcells continues to shrink, the height of buildings continues to increase , the height of the antenna is generally lower than the average height of urban buildings, and the influence of the top of the building on the propagation of radio waves is small, so the building is modeled as a right prism or a combination of right prisms.
